We are bridging the gap between advanced genetics and practical agriculture by developing the next generation of Hi-Flav Corn & Sorghum varieties.
We are validating the use of Hi-Flav corn as a functional feed ingredient. Rich in natural anthocyanins and antioxidants, our varieties are designed to improve gut health and immunity in flocks, offering producers a pathway to reduce antibiotic usage while maintaining high production standards.
We provide craft distillers with a unique competitive edge through our specialized grains. Our varieties impart vibrant natural red and purple pigments alongside novel flavor profiles, allowing for the creation of distinctive, high-value spirits that stand out on the shelf.
Farmers face increasing abiotic stresses from changing climates. Our sorghum and corn varieties are bred for superior resilience and stress tolerance, allowing growers to reduce chemical inputs and secure identity-preserved contracts for high-value output.
